Abstract
We give a simple quantum private comparison protocol with quantum key distribution and hash function, in which two distrustful parties can compare whether their secrets are equal with the help of a semi-trusted party. We also analyze the security of this protocol and show that its security is based on the fundamental principles of quantum mechanics and the irreversibility of hash function.
